Understanding Aluminium as a Material
Aluminium is a lightweight yet strong metal, understood for its resistance to rust and environmental wear. Unlike other materials such as wood or steel, aluminium doesn't warp, crack, or swell, making it especially ideal for doors and windows. Additionally, aluminium can be easily recycled, which lowers environmental effect.
Secret Features of Aluminium Windows and Doors
Toughness: Aluminium frames can endure extreme climate condition, including severe temperatures, rain, and wind. They are resistant to rust, rot, and insect problem, guaranteeing a long life-span.
Low Maintenance: Unlike wood, which needs routine painting or sealing, aluminium doors and windows need minimal maintenance. An easy wash with soap and water from time to time is adequate to keep them looking fresh.
Energy Efficiency: Advanced thermal break innovation used in numerous aluminium windows and doors avoids condensation and heat loss. This feature can assist decrease energy bills by maintaining indoor temperature levels.
Visual Appeal: Available in different designs, colors, and finishes, aluminium frames can match any architectural style. They provide a contemporary appearance without sacrificing functionality.
Security: Aluminium is naturally strong, and a lot of makers reinforce their frames with additional security functions, making them a safe choice for homes.
Kinds Of Aluminium Windows and Doors
Aluminium windows and doors come in a variety of styles to fit different needs and preferences:
Casement Windows: Hinged on one side, these windows open external, enabling maximum ventilation.
Sliding Windows: These windows slide open horizontally, providing an unobstructed view and easy operation.
Bi-fold Doors: Ideal for producing smooth transitions between indoor and outside areas, bi-fold doors can fold away to the side.
French Doors: With a timeless visual, French doors can enhance the visual appeal of any entryway.
Lift-and-Slide Doors: These doors offer a contemporary option for large openings, permitting for simple operation with minimal effort.

Factors To Consider When Choosing Aluminium Windows and Doors
While aluminium doors and windows provide many benefits, it is vital to consider a few essential aspects before buying:
Initial Cost: Aluminium frames can be costlier than vinyl options however frequently supply better durability and energy cost savings in time.
Heat Conductivity: Aluminium is a conductor of heat, suggesting without appropriate thermal breaks, heat loss can occur. It is important to select premium items designed with this in mind.
Color Options: While aluminium frames can be powder-coated in numerous colors, some property owners might prefer the natural appearance of wood or other products.
Guarantee and Manufacturer: Always examine the warranty terms and the reputation of the manufacturer. Quality can vary considerably between brands.
Tips for Installation and Maintenance
Hire Professionals: While some proficient DIY lovers might try their setups, hiring experts ensures security and optimum fitting.
Routine Inspections: It's advisable to inspect seals and caulking each year to make sure no air or water leaks.
Clean Regularly: Use moderate cleaning agents to clean up the frames and glass. Prevent abrasive cleaners that may scratch the finish.
